Medium garnet, quite deep for the variety, turning to brick on the rim. Nose is fully developed and fragrant. Still has fruit, cherry and strawberry marmelade. Forest growth and mushrooms. In the mouth it is medium bodied, alcohol is 13.5% but does not show. Acidity is medium + but well balanced by the fruit. Marmelade notes of strawberry very evident as is the forest floor, hints of licorice and tar. Beutiful Pinot, very ripe fruit, and good balance between freshness and ripeness. Surely the best Pinot from Alsace I have ever tasted.
